Item 2.04 and Item 8.01. | | Triggering Events That Accelerate or Increase a Direct Financial Obligation or an Obligation under an Off-Balance Sheet Arrangement; and Other Events. |
On September 8, 2006, the Board of Directors of the Company’s subsidiaries, Jafra Cosmetics International, Inc. (“JCI”), and Distribuidora Comercial Jafra, S.A. de C.V. (“DCJ”) authorized JCI and DCJ to purchase such portion of the 10-3/4% Senior Subordinated Notes Due 2011 issued by JCI and DCJ (U.S. $130 million currently outstanding combined for both) as determined by management from time-to-time, as permitted by the Company’s senior credit agreement. The note repurchases, if any, may take place at management’s discretion and/or under pre-established, non-discretionary programs from time to time, depending on market conditions, in the open market and/or in privately negotiated transactions. JCI and DCJ intend to obtain the funding for any such purchases from cash on hand, loans from affiliates or borrowings under the Company’s senior credit agreement. JCI and DCJ have reserved the right not to purchase any of the notes in their sole discretion. Apart from such voluntary transactions, the notes can be redeemed in whole or in part commencing on May 15, 2007 at premiums declining to par in the sixth year.
